Subframe connectors are a must chassis upgrade when racing and hard driving habits are present. They greatly improve your car's handling ability while reducing t-top squeaks, dash rattles and quarter panel flexing. Subframe connectors essentially tie the front and rear steel subframes together, resulting in a stiffened and strengthened chassis, allowing better weight transfer and improved traction when launching. When strength is a concern, square tubing has greater torsion resistance over tubular designs. Will work with all aftermarket exhaust systems and does not effect ground clearance. This weld-in style requires no bolts to tighten ever and less chance of flex compared to bolt-in types.
